What a dealership service manager needs from automotive two post lifts

A franchise dealer runs the widest possible vehicle mix under one roof. Compact hybrids, midsize crossovers, half-ton pickups, and occasional heavy-duty gas trucks brought in for warranty, plus service loaners and demos. That is 3,000 to 8,500 pound curb weights on the same lifts all day, every day. The service manager we were talking to also had two customer-pay techs on flat-rate and two warranty techs on hourly, and the flat-rate guys wanted the fastest cycle time from vehicle in the bay to arms locked. Automotive two post lifts have to serve both crowds. They have to swing arms fast and land pads accurately for a rushed lube job, and they have to be positioned rigidly and precisely enough for a transmission drop with a jack. Symmetric and asymmetric arms behave differently in each situation. We started by asking what percentage of their vehicle traffic was under 4,500 pounds. He said 70 percent. That single number drives the arm decision most of the time.

Symmetric arms: the geometry and where they belong

On a symmetric lift, the columns face each other directly and both arms are the same length front and back. The vehicle sits with roughly half its wheelbase forward of the columns and half behind. The load is centered between the columns. Symmetric geometry is preferred for heavier vehicles because the load line stays close to column center, which reduces cantilever stress on the arm pins. If your fleet leans toward 3/4-ton and one-ton pickups, symmetric arms are almost always the answer. The downside for a franchise dealership is door swing. On a symmetric lift, the driver’s door lands right at the column, and a customer or tech opening the door hits the post at about 60 degrees. That is fine for a heavy-duty diesel bay where doors barely open anyway. It is annoying for a lube tech doing 22 cars a day on Camrys and RAV4s. Symmetric automotive two post lifts belong in truck bays, alignment prep bays, and any location where 5,000-plus pound vehicles are the majority of what rolls in.

Asymmetric arms: rotated columns and the load balance

On an asymmetric lift, the columns are rotated roughly 30 degrees so the arms are longer at the back and shorter at the front. The vehicle sits with about 70 percent of its wheelbase behind the columns. That puts the driver-side door forward of the column entirely, so it opens 90 degrees with room to spare. Techs love asymmetric lifts for cars because they can walk in and out of the vehicle with the door fully open. The load line, however, sits farther back and slightly outboard, which loads the rear arms more heavily and puts more moment on the arm pins. That is fine at 4,000 to 5,000 pounds. It becomes a problem for pickups pushing 7,000 pounds. This is why you rarely see pure asymmetric lifts specced for heavy-duty truck shops. For a dealership car-heavy bay, asymmetric is the right call. For a heavy-duty pickup bay, asymmetric is a mistake. The 70-30 mix at the Council Bluffs dealership told us their four new bays should be asymmetric, because the cars they see far outweigh the trucks in bay-hours consumed.

Versymmetric: the hybrid design for mixed traffic

Rotary and Challenger both offer versymmetric arms that combine mostly-symmetric arm length with slight column rotation. You get most of the door-swing benefit of a full asymmetric and most of the load-centering benefit of a symmetric. For a general-service bay in a mixed dealership, versymmetric is genuinely the sweet spot. We recommended it for two of the four new bays at this dealership, keeping the other two as full asymmetric for the volume lube work. The service manager was initially skeptical because versymmetric adds cost and one more part number for arm rebuild kits down the road. But over ten years of use, the flexibility pays back in fewer "can we move that truck to the other bay" conversations. Automotive two post lifts are a 15-to-20-year investment. Splitting the difference between symmetric and asymmetric with a versymmetric option is worth the small upfront delta on a dealership install. Real dimensions from a Council Bluffs install

Here are the numbers from that job. Bay footprint per lift: 12 feet wide, 24 feet deep. Ceiling height clear: 12 feet 8 inches. Column height: 11 feet 6 inches for the overhead versions. Between-columns width: 9 feet on the asymmetric setups, 8 feet 6 inches on the versymmetric. Lifting height at fully raised: 74 to 76 inches under-pad. Concrete thickness verified before drilling: 5.5 inches nominal, spot-checked at 5.25 minimum. Anchor pattern: 3/4-inch wedge anchors, four per column, 4.5-inch embed. Power: three-phase 208V at 30 amps, hardwired from the sub-panel with a lockable disconnect within sight of each lift. Full install of all four lifts across two long weekends so the service department stayed open during the week. This is the kind of dimensional work we do on every commercial job. Capacity, drive-through width, and lifting height numbers

The four bays landed on 10,000 pound automotive two post lifts. That capacity is more than they will ever load; the biggest trucks they warranty are around 8,500 pounds. But going with 10K instead of 9K bought them a taller column, a slightly longer arm range, and about 4 more inches of lifting height. Drive-through width matters too. A dually pickup with a chase-package box measures 96 inches wide across the mirrors. Between-column clearance on a 10K lift is typically 100 to 105 inches. That is enough, barely. On a lift with the arms parked forward, a tech can drive a dually straight through. On a 9K lift with 96 inches between columns, you cannot. Lifting height at 74 to 76 inches under-pad lets a 6-foot tech stand under the vehicle without a stooped back all day. Small differences in those three numbers — capacity, between-column width, and lifting height — separate a good bay from a great bay. The dealership was happy to pay the small delta for the bigger numbers.

Choosing the right pair of automotive two post lifts for a dealership

If you are speccing lifts for a franchise dealership, our default recommendation is two full-asymmetric 10,000 lb lifts for the lube-and-tire bays, two versymmetric 10K lifts for general service, and one symmetric 12K or 15K lift for the truck or diesel bay. If you only have four bays to work with, drop the symmetric truck bay and add another versymmetric. You can do warranty pickup work on versymmetric arms without penalty as long as you center the load carefully. Automotive two post lifts installed correctly last 15 to 20 years in daily commercial service before requiring a major rebuild — cylinders reseal, cables get replaced every five to seven years, arm restraints inspected annually. It is a capital purchase you make once and live with. Get the arm configuration right for the vehicle mix you actually run, not the mix you wish you ran.
